1. Is a licensed certified home health. That means it is approved by the TDHS to provide services to patients with Medicare & Private Pay.

2. Offers the specific health care services you need (nursing/physical therapy).

3. Meets your special needs (like language or cultural preference).

4. Offers the personal care services you need (like bathing, dressing, and using the bathroom).

5. Will help you arrange for additional services, such as Meals on Wheels & provider services that you may need.

6. Has staff available to provide the type and hours of care your doctor ordered, and can start when you need them.

7. Is recommended by your hospital discharge, doctor, or social worker.

8. Has staff available at night and on weekends for emergencies.

9. Explains what your insurance will cover, and what you must pay out-of-pocket.

10. Does background checks on all staff.

11. Has letters from satisfied patients, family members, and doctors that testify to the home health staff providing good service.
